Hungry Ghost Coffee, New York

Hungry Ghost Coffee is a cozy West Village cafΓ© where neighborhood rhythm, specialty coffee, and quiet simplicity converge into something grounded, familiar, and effortlessly dependable.

Set along Bleecker Street near the intersection with Grove Street, this understated coffee shop draws a steady mix of locals, freelancers, and passersby into a space that feels lived-in and approachable. The atmosphere is immediate, soft lighting, a narrow layout, and a steady flow of people moving in and out with purpose. There's a calm energy to it, not silent, but controlled, with conversations kept low and laptops occasionally open along the edges. It's not trying to be a destination cafΓ© or design statement, but it holds its own through consistency. Hungry Ghost doesn't demand attention. It earns routine.

Hungry Ghost Coffee builds its identity around straightforward, high-quality coffee, focusing on consistency and accessibility.

The offerings lean into classic espresso drinks, drip coffee, and a small selection of pastries, all executed with a level of reliability that regulars come to expect. What defines Hungry Ghost is its simplicity, drinks that are well-made without unnecessary flair, allowing the quality of the beans and preparation to carry the experience. There's a noticeable emphasis on efficiency, orders moving quickly without sacrificing care, making it an ideal spot for both quick stops and brief pauses.
